The Planning Stage involves:
Preparing a baseline plan for each project, as this provides a clear definition of how the project scope will be accomplished on time, to budget and using available resources.
A number of detailed plans will be drawn up. They are:
A time plan - This plan includes estimated completion date of activities and the project as a whole.
A cost plan - This plan is used to create a budget for the project.
A quality plan - It details the standards that must be maintained in order to ensure a successful development process.
A resource plan - It checks peaks and troughs of workload to ensure the plan is feasible and lists purchases to be bought.
A contingency plan - It includes contingency plans for key risks.
A communication plan - It identifies members of the project team, planned methods of communication, etc.
